Transaction 3fc77f345b941fa0d91e2d84de8d33a8e26da4521dc2884cba92f1ed860445aa

1 Input
2 Outputs
  • 3fc77f345b941fa0d91e2d84de8d33a8e26da4521dc2884cba92f1ed860445aa:0
  • value  14100000000
    address  17pdu9njpsjXZejEYHYuL73sQMvyDeYWCn
  • 3fc77f345b941fa0d91e2d84de8d33a8e26da4521dc2884cba92f1ed860445aa:1
  • value  10000000000
    address  14NxNcYM5WFG7N9NmcQioT5JxZjh5dbTET